The Role of Data Scientists

Data Scientist

Data scientists use a combination of statistics, programming, and domain expertise to extract valuable insights from information (data) to support an organization’s decision-making processes. Their work typically entails collecting and cleaning large datasets, and then using analytical tools, artificial intelligence, and computer programs to identify patterns or make predictions. They then communicate their findings in ways that business leaders can understand (such as in charts or reports) and act on the results.

A lead data scientist, also called a Director/Head of Data Science or Chief Data Scientist, is responsible for guiding a team of data scientists, setting strategic direction, and ensuring their work supports the organization’s overall objectives. They also foster collaboration, mentor team members, and ensure projects progress as intended. Finally, they ensure that data is used in ethical, scalable, and impactful ways that help facilitate the company’s success.
